<br />. <br /> <br />. <br /> <br />. <br /> <br />Consent Agenda Item 1.1 <br />Case No. 6-06CW49: Application of Upper Yampa Water Conservancy <br /> <br />Application Summary <br /> <br />This is an application for approval of an umbrella plan for augmentation to replace out-of-priority <br />depletions from various structures located within the boundaries of the Upper Yampa Water <br />Conservancy District in Routt and Moffat Counties. The purpose of the plan for augmentation is to <br />establish a framework to include new water users into a decreed plan for augmentation under which <br />the Upper Yampa District will replace out of priority depletions with the District's senior water <br />rights that include Yamcolo Reservoir, Stagecoach Reservoir, and Mad Creek. The total maximum <br />amount of augmentation water involved in and committed by the District to this plan is 2,000 acre- <br />feet. The rate of exchange applied for to support the plan for augmentation is 7.6 cfs. These <br />amounts have been allocated to specific regions within the District's boundaries. <br /> <br />CWCB ApPfopriations <br /> <br />The CWCB holds a number of instream flow water rights within the boundaries of the Upper <br />Yampa District that could be injured by this application (see attached map). <br /> <br />Potential fOf In iurv <br /> <br />The Applicant's proposed plan for augmentation may injure the Board's instream flow water rights <br />within the Applicant's boundaries by not replacing out-of-priority depletions in time, place and <br />amount. <br /> <br />Othef Obiectors <br /> <br />The City of Steamboat Springs, Steamboat Alpine Development, LLC, Catamount Development, <br />Inc., Catamount Metropolitan District, The City of Craig, Tri-State Generation and Transmission <br />Association, Inc., Dequine Family, L.L.C., Flying Diamond Resources, Kim Singleton, State and <br />Division Engineers, Sidney Peak Ranch Owners' Association, Inc., JBM Ranch, LLC, United States <br />of America - U.S.D.A. Forest Service, and the Colorado Division of Wildlife and the Wildlife <br />Cornmission also filed statements of opposition to this application. <br />
